Runbook: Scanline barcode bridge

If warehouse scans stop flowing into Cartwheel, it's almost always the bridge service on the Dunmore floor box wedging after a USB hiccup. Bounce the service first — nine times out of ten that fixes it. If not, check the queue depth before escalating. When restarting, make sure the bridge comes up with these settings.

deployment values, yafop-bajef:
[gilok]
team = ulaius
access_code = ac_423664
host = gilok.sivrelhq.corp
port = 9200
owner = pelius.istax
peer = eliok.torvasoft.internal

## Authentication

The Emberledger loyalty-points service enforces scoped bearer authentication on all write paths. On-call engineers performing ledger reconciliation must use a token with the ledger:repair scope only; broader scopes will be rejected by the audit proxy and logged as anomalies. Tokens rotate every 24 hours, so confirm yours is current. For tonight's rotation, use the bearer token below.

portal login ticket: eyJhbGciOiJIUzI1NiIsInR5cCI6IkpXVCJ9.eyJzdWIiOiIMjvRAf3PEFIn0.nuv9gjixLtnr

Capacity note for the Bramblewick export retry queue. Failed exports are requeued with exponential backoff, and the queue depth is our main capacity signal: sustained depth above the high-water mark means downstream Pellis storage is saturated, not that we need more workers. As the new contractor, please don't raise worker counts without checking storage latency first — it usually makes things worse. Retry timing, backoff caps, and the high-water threshold are all driven by the constants shown below.

limits module of yagef-bajog:
TIERS = {
    "druael": 370,
    "tamix": 286,
    "pelius": 541,
    "pelael": 78,
    "pelox": 47,
    "ralath": 533,
    "drumir": 801,
}